Army Repel Boko Haram Attack in Yobe, Two Soldiers Killed as Terrorists Suffer Casualties

Troops of Operation HADIN KAI have repelled a late-night attack by suspected Islamic State West Africa Province (ISWAP) and Jama’atu Ahlis Sunna Lidda’awati wal-Jihad (JAS) terrorists on a military checkpoint along the Buni Yadi–Buni Gari road in Gujba Local Government Area of Yobe State.
Security sources said the attack occurred at about 10:45 p.m. when heavily armed insurgents launched an assault on the checkpoint manned by troops of the 27 Task Force Brigade.
The troops engaged the attackers in a fierce gun battle, successfully thwarting the assault and forcing the terrorists to retreat after sustaining casualties, although the exact number of those killed has yet to be determined.
Despite the successful defence, two soldiers lost their lives while courageously confronting the attackers.
Military sources also confirmed that one military gun truck was destroyed during the exchange, while one QJC machine gun and one AK-47 rifle were reported missing. Efforts are ongoing to recover the weapons.
Security forces have commenced exploitation of the area to assess the extent of casualties inflicted on the fleeing terrorists and recover any abandoned weapons or equipment.
Reinforcements have since been deployed to the area to strengthen security and prevent any renewed attacks.
The latest incident underscores the continued attempts by ISWAP/JAS elements to target military positions in the North-East despite sustained counterinsurgency operations by Operation HADIN KAI aimed at dismantling terrorist strongholds.
Military authorities said troops remain on high alert and are continuing clearance and pursuit operations to track down the fleeing terrorists and deny them freedom of movement across the theatre.
